Sun Day Red’s New Tiger-Engineered Polo Aims to Become Best in Golf
Tiger Woods’s Sun Day Red brand is one of the newest and hottest brands in the golf apparel space, and it has a new polo on the way that aims to be one of the best in the industry.
Most may not know this, but Tiger has a very direct involvement in what Sun Day Red designs and releases.
The company, along with its Senior Creative Director Cáje Moye and President Brad Blankenship, told me that everything from the buttons to the collar to the colors are all suggested by Tiger using his decades of experience with apparel.
The new lineup of polos is no different. Designed with a classic fit, the “Heritage” lineup is not your typical collared golf shirt. It features things like an extended back, high-end performance material, and a lightweight design that is ideal for a variety of playing conditions.
The above colors are not the only ones that will be available. The Heritage Polo will be sold in 14 different designs.
Heritage Lineup Features
Fit
Polos should not be restrictive to a golf swing, but they should still have a fitted look that allows you to look your best on the course.
That’s what Tiger had in mind for this polo specifically. Although it is a perfect balance between slim and roomy, the Heritage polos will not restrict a golfer from completing their full swing radius.
Shirt Tail
Tiger wears polos on the course and at the range during practice. This required a special length shirt tail that would be suitable for both.
With older polos, Tiger said he felt as if he was stuffing yards of fabric in his pants, leading to an uncomfortable fit. That also made these shirts unsuitable for an untucked option when you’re enjoying a casual round or hitting balls on the range.

The shirt tail on the Heritage lineup is slightly stepped on for the perfect amount of fabric to tuck without the bulk. When coupled with a silicone-banded waistband, like what is featured in the Dynam pant, the shirt will stay tucked, keeping you looking sharp throughout the round.
Materials
Apparel is as important as clubs in Tiger’s eyes. When I spoke with the Sun Day Red team, they told me they were astounded by Tiger’s attention to detail in terms of materials and how a polo should react to humidity and various temperatures.

Multiple materials and versions of the Heritage polo were tested by Tiger personally, one of which came during the U.S. Open at Pinehurst earlier this year. The team said that on Friday, they knew changes would be made when the humid and hot conditions in North Carolina had Tiger sweating through his material.
This initial release of the polo has a variety of performance and weighting options that are ideal for various playing conditions. If it’s hot one day or cool another, there’s a polo in this lineup for that.
A Finish that Stays Clean
The collar will stay crisp, keeping the look of the shirt clean and fresh. This was a focus of Tiger’s with this polo, as a collar that can maintain the heat and the wear and tear during a long day of golf.
It also features premium pearl buttons that were requested in a fashion that Tiger needs. The first button can be left undone, maintaining the perfect spread as traditionally worn. This makes the shirt ideal for both on and off-course settings.
